Output 629b075156aa6eb16d91a39bacb91d1bbf5e0d2f1ab71eb75b97948f08908cf1:0

value
19385140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79895cfdc190eab58cd84476f1490356964cae1f OP_EQUALVERIFY OP_CHECKSIG
address
1C5dKNsuwgw26K6vbwCHWoH8Dfbo1CRQM4
transaction
629b075156aa6eb16d91a39bacb91d1bbf5e0d2f1ab71eb75b97948f08908cf1
spent
true